WASHINGTON (DC News Now) — As high temperatures sweep the region, many locations are making changes to Fourth of July celebration plans.
DC News Now has compiled a list of changes to Fourth of July celebrations in the DMV.
Montgomery County issues Heat Emergency Alert, adjusts fireworks events
Washington, D.C.
Washington, D.C.’s large fireworks show hosted by Freedom 250 on Saturday is continuing with some changes to the original schedule. Gates for the show will open at 5 p.m. instead of 1 p.m. to reduce prolonged exposure to the heat. The fireworks are scheduled for 10:30 p.m.
Maryland
Poolesville in Montgomery County rescheduled its Fourth of July fireworks to July 5. Parking gates open at 5 p.m.
Takoma Park in Montgomery County canceled its 4th of July parade and street party during the heat. In an announcement, city officials said, “We feel that it would not be safe, or responsible, to ask our community to march or to gather in this heat.”…
